MARTIN COUNTY, Fla. — Matthew Theobald’s future could soon be in the hands of an administrative law judge.
On Tuesday, school board members voted 3-2, to allow an administrative hearing for Theobald, meaning a third party would take the case.

Theobald, a teacher and president of the Martin County teachers union, was suspended without pay after calling Charlie Kirk a “racist, misogynistic, fear-mongering neo-nazi” on Facebook.
“Matt is not just a teacher; he goes above and beyond when anyone is in need,” said his wife, Kaylin Rowell. “You all should be ashamed of yourselves. I also do not need to tell you that these actions are also highly unconstitutional.”
